This feels especially urgent with the rise of digital fatigue and feelings of isolation among young adults. Recent research shows that over 60% of Gen Z adults say they’re lonelier today than they were 10 years ago, while 80% believe in-person events build better connections. Other studies indicate that 95% of 18- to 35-year-olds are eager to explore interests and communities they’ve discovered online through in-person events, and 45% are looking for a sense of belonging when joining a community.

Meetup provides the tools and space to create the in-person connections this generation craves—and we’re seeing the impact. Adult Gen Z (ages 18–28) and young Millennials (ages 29-35) make up 40% of our monthly active users and are the most active age group on the platform.

What’s new?

Every update to the appearance and usability was included to delight new and existing members and organizers, while preserving the logical flow that our community knows and depends on.

Highlights include:

  • A vibrant visual identity. An updated logo, lively color palette, updated fonts, and new icons and illustrations make Meetup feel more energetic and inviting.
  • Photography front and center. The new identity features high-quality photos of real people, while members and organizers are encouraged to add their own images to bring groups and experiences to life.
  • Streamlined design. Improved spacing, visual contrast, and clearer information hierarchy make the platform easier to navigate and content easier to read.
  • Faster discovery. Better structure and interaction help people find relevant groups and events more quickly.
  • More context for events and groups. Data, photos, and prominent reviews give members a better sense of what to expect before RSVPing to an event or joining a group—an important consideration for many who experience anxiety in unfamiliar social situations.

Crucially, we wanted to be sure that the experience stayed familiar to our existing community where it mattered: Core navigation and key steps are unchanged—there’s no need for you to relearn how to do anything on the platform.

As of today, Meetup’s new experience is live on Web, and we’re working on bringing it to Mobile soon!
